Output 3f8e189a7cf8d4bb2c4f77a3853f328929744eec1bbde092e7d0125f04e2d9d1:1

value
16670004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c7e44a15cf7ff1e88d87e0b17b1349bdfd1417 OP_EQUAL
address
3HzKfQryHU3M9WZeRYtdqRh9HBpnU7hx9Z
transaction
3f8e189a7cf8d4bb2c4f77a3853f328929744eec1bbde092e7d0125f04e2d9d1
confirmations
425780
spent
true